Commercial Description:
Copper colored ale. Highly hopped with bold aroma & flavorable finish.

Hazy dark golden straw. Sticky, dense alabaster head. Minimal carbonation. Grapefruit rind, orange peel, pine needle aroma with a floral aspect as well. Bold and crisp and immediately toasty with a citric, pine needle hop balance. Moderately bitter. Dry and very clean finishing. Assertively hopped but nicely balanced as well. Medium light body. Very quenching. Finishes with a showcase of Cascades, though tame when compared to some versions, and a dry malt toastedness. A great session brew.

My Bottom Line:
This American Pale Ale offers citrusy, spicy hops that tend to outshine the lightly toasted malts in a lean vehicle chock full of leafy bitterness.

Further Personal Perceptions:
-A creamy sheet of foam sits atop the dark golden.
-Like all of the beers I had there that day, this was "rustic" tasting. Just a tad dirty, if I may say so.
-The smooth carbonation helps drinkability.
-The hoppy finish was probably my favorite moment in each sip.

On tap at the brewpub.

Draft at the pub. Medium sized offwhite head, good retention and lace. Clear gold/light copper color. Spicey hop nose, light citrus and caramel malts. Body is lightly medium, good carbonation, lightly slick. Clean and crisp citrusy hop notes, spicey and fruity with a little light tropical tinge and goodly balanced malts. Fairly dry, crisp clean citrus finish.
